Energy-saving lighting method for building
The invention discloses an energy-saving lighting method for buildings. The method comprises the following steps of: burying an assembled lighting box on the ground of a balcony so as to diffusely reflect outside light into a room for lighting, starting a water-scraping electric motor to drive a water-collecting strip to scrape water drops on toughened glass in the lighting box after a storage battery stores electricity, then fixing an assembled daylighting panel outside a window frame, and after the storage battery stores electricity, starting a displacement electric motor and a swing electric motor to drive the daylighting panel so as to adjust a reflection angle. The daylighting box is buried on the balcony ground, the daylighting panel is installed outside the window, the diffuse reflection plane mirror and the diffuse reflection cambered surface mirror in the daylighting box and the daylighting panel can reflect outdoor light to an indoor ceiling in a diffuse reflection mode, refract the light and scatter the light downwards, so the indoor space is brightened; and therefore, electricity utilization cost is saved, and energy conservation of the building is facilitated.
